SETTING THE NUMBER OF RINGS

The ring select switch on the back of the DTAM controls how
long the DTAM waits before it answers a call. Slide the switch
to the desired position.
2 The DTAM answers after two rings.
4 The DTAM answers after four rings.
7 The DTAM answers after seven rings.
T.S. (Toll Saver) - If there are new messages, the DTAM
answers after two rings. Otherwise, the DTAM answers after
four rings. This helps you avoid unnecessary toll charges when
calling by long distance to check your messages. If you hear
more than two rings, you know you can hang up because the
DTAM has no new messages.
NOTE:
• When the memory is full the DTAM answers the call and
plays OGM2 (the announce only message).
